Output 4043728891361f65fe9a7eedf1eb7a1b27164fd334a82a021ed0858f11262316:2

value
18042055
script pubkey
OP_0 OP_PUSHBYTES_20 730ec19460ee5e522973b25ff60d8ecb9208987b
address
bc1qwv8vr9rqae09y2tnkf0lvrvwewfq3xrm02me98
transaction
4043728891361f65fe9a7eedf1eb7a1b27164fd334a82a021ed0858f11262316
spent
true